Event Description

1st International Conference on Canadian Agri-food & Rural Advisory, Extension, and Education (CAREE)

The conference focuses on the following topics to explore concepts, frameworks, methods, tools, experiences, and empirical evidence related to the transformative processes of the agri-food system and rural development.

Topics:
1: Policy, Approaches, Trends, and Evidence-based Action
2: Digitalization and Responsible Use of AI in Advisory Services and Education
3: Indigenous and Northern Development, Social Inclusion, and Well-being of Agricultural and Rural Communities
4: Extension, Education, and Institutional Capacity for Driving Agri-food Systems Transformation
5: Extension and Advisory to Facilitate Entrepreneurship, Bio-economy, Food Safety, Agro-ecology, Animal Welfare, and Resilience to Climate Change
6: Extension, Media, Rural and Risk Communication Services

conference will help us get some insights into the overarching questions: What does agri-food & rural advisory and extension look like across Canada? Is it worthwhile to work on this topic, especially considering our global and regional reputation? What is the rigour and value of this discipline for those supporting agri-food systems and rural development?
